Standardization
The development of standardized shipping containers revolutionized global trade by making it more efficient and cost-effective. explains how Malcolm McLean's innovation in 1956, using a World War II tanker to transport containers, laid the groundwork for modern container shipping. This innovation was crucial for establishing a global standard, as McLean's patents were made royalty-free, allowing for widespread adoption.
The vast majority of shipping containers conform to these standards, that being 8ft wide, eight and a half feet high, with a length of either 20 or 40ft.

The International Maritime Organization's standards further facilitated the construction of ships and port facilities designed for these standardized units, significantly boosting global trade efficiency 1.

Economic Impact
The economic impact of containerization was profound, drastically reducing the costs of trade and fueling global economic growth. highlights how the cost to load a ton of goods dropped significantly, making international shipping more accessible and affordable. This transformation was pivotal in boosting Japanese exports and their economy, as cheap shipping became a catalyst for economic expansion.
The cost savings from container shipping caused global trade to explode.

The shift from labor-intensive break bulk shipping to container shipping also led to renegotiated contracts with dock workers, reflecting the new efficiencies and economic realities 1.
